David Curnow
2018-08-15 21:11:53 GMT

We all had a really good and enjoyable time and the set up on site was brilliant. We felt that the price was really good value for money. The site looks inviting with mowed pathways through long natural grass leading you to your camp. The camps are perfectly spaced out so that you feel you have your own space. Being able to have a small camp fire makes the whole experience more social as you can all sit around and enjoy the evening. We had some rain on the last day but all camps come with a shelter, benches and tables which are brilliant so you can still enjoy being outside. Will and Patricia were very friendly and informative, if we had any questions or wanted anything such as logs for the fire then they would drop them off in the afternoon. We were lucky enough to have a shower in the next field, this was a temporary thing as the leisure centre was having building work and this is what would be available normally if you wanted a shower. The shower in the field was no thrills but perfect for doing what you need it to do! This would be a good thing to keep in my opinion. All in all amazing time and will be returning at some point in the future. Thanks guys!

About Monmouth
Town in Wales

Monmouth is a town and community in Wales. It is situated where the River Monnow joins the River Wye, two miles from the Wales–England border. Monmouth is 30 miles northeast of Cardiff, and 113 miles west of London. It is within the Monmouthshire local authority, and the parliamentary constituency of Monmouth. The population in the 2011 census was 10,508, rising from 8,877 in 2001. Monmouth is the historic county town of Monmouthshire although Abergavenny is now the county town. source
